Michael Ciminella and Naomi Judd’s Marriage

Michael married Naomi Judd in 1964, long before she became a country music star.

At the time, Naomi was known by her birth name, Diana Ellen Judd. They were both extremely young and faced complicated family responsibilities.

Naomi already had a daughter, Christina Ciminella, who later became famous as Wynonna Judd. Wynonna’s biological father was Charles Jordan, but Michael served as an early father figure and gave her his surname.

Michael and Naomi later welcomed their biological daughter, Ashley Tyler Ciminella, on April 19, 1968.

The family moved to California, but the marriage did not last. Michael and Naomi divorced in 1972 when Ashley was four years old.

Did Michael Benefit From Naomi Judd’s Music Fortune?

There is no reliable evidence that Michael built his net worth from Naomi Judd’s later music success.

Michael and Naomi divorced in 1972. Naomi and Wynonna did not become successful recording stars until the 1980s, approximately a decade later.

After the divorce, Naomi worked, studied nursing, and raised the girls. She and Wynonna eventually moved to Nashville, where they pursued a recording career as The Judds.

The group signed with RCA Records in 1983 and became one of country music’s most successful duos.

Because Michael’s marriage to Naomi ended long before that success, it would be incorrect to assume that he shared in all her later music earnings.

A divorce settlement may have existed, but the financial terms are not publicly established. There is no sound basis for claiming that Naomi’s royalties created Michael’s fortune.

Michael and Ashley’s Relationship

Michael and Ashley have remained connected despite the divorce between her parents.

Their relationship became publicly visible after Ashley suffered a terrible accident in the Democratic Republic of the Congo in February 2021.

She tripped over a fallen tree in the rainforest and shattered her leg. The injury caused multiple fractures, nerve damage, internal bleeding, and a difficult rescue lasting many hours.

After Ashley reached a hospital in South Africa, she sent Michael an urgent message asking him to come.

Michael flew to Johannesburg because he had already received his COVID-19 vaccination. He then helped Ashley complete a difficult journey back to the United States involving four flights over approximately 22 hours.

This event revealed Michael as a father who responded during a serious emergency. His financial position mattered much less than his willingness to travel across the world when his daughter needed him.

Public Appearances With Ashley and Naomi

Michael has occasionally appeared with Ashley and Naomi at entertainment events.

In March 2013, all three attended the premiere of Olympus Has Fallen in Los Angeles. Photographs from the event remain among the most widely available images of Michael.

The appearance showed Michael and Naomi supporting their daughter many years after their divorce.

He also appeared as Ashley’s father in a 2011 episode of the genealogy series Who Do You Think You Are?

These appearances did not create a regular entertainment income for Michael. They were family-related events rather than evidence of a film or television career.
